Prompt Response, Leading the Establishment of Foreign Educational Institutions in Opportunity Development Zones
The Nation's First Special Zone Investment Company, Supported by Local Tax Exemptions and Investment Subsidies
Since being designated as a Government Opportunity Development Zone in June, Gumi City in Gyeongbuk Province has been proactively responding to improving living conditions and deregulation, including nationwide first support for investment company incentives and establishing grounds for foreign educational institutions (international schools) within the zone.
The Opportunity Development Zone is an area that supports large-scale local investments through a package of △tax and financial support △regulatory exemptions △living conditions. On June 25, by the Ministry of Trade, Industry and Energy's announcement, the Gumi National Industrial Complex was designated as a zone of about 570,000 pyeong, focusing on semiconductors, defense industry, and secondary batteries.
Gumi City has long recognized that many domestic and foreign investment companies pointed out the lack of quality educational infrastructure as a difficulty in local investment, and has been seeking improvement measures. To resolve this, the city is focusing on gathering opinions from companies and workers and establishing a legal basis for the establishment of foreign educational institutions (international schools).
To this end, in August, Gumi City proposed the necessity of establishing an international school to Prime Minister Han Duck-soo at the 'Opportunity Development Zone Central-Local Cooperation Meeting,' and repeatedly explained the need for establishing an international school within the Gumi Opportunity Development Zone to Han Dong-hoon, the leader of the People Power Party, the Ministry of Trade, Industry and Energy, and the National Assembly.

원본보기 아이콘Recently, a special bill allowing the establishment of international schools within the Opportunity Development Zone was submitted through the National Assembly's Industry, Trade, and Energy Special Committee, and formal discussions have begun. If the special law passes within this year, Gumi City is expected to secure the legal basis for establishing international schools, making significant progress in improving educational infrastructure.
Gumi City confirmed tax reductions and financial support for two companies within the Opportunity Development Zone. Defense industry specialist Company A received local tax (acquisition tax, etc.) reduction benefits, and secondary battery equipment specialist Company B received an additional 5% support on top of the original local investment promotion subsidy rate. This is the first investment attraction incentive applied nationwide for companies investing and settling in the Opportunity Development Zone, and it is expected to serve as an opportunity for Gumi City to attract corporate investment and revitalize the local economy.
The city plans to link the Opportunity Development Zone with the semiconductor specialized complex and defense innovation cluster to promote industrial transformation into advanced industries such as semiconductors, defense industry, and secondary batteries, and to expand related corporate investments. Through this, the goal is to achieve a major transformation of the Gumi Industrial Complex.
Mayor Kim Jang-ho said, “Gumi City has achieved great results through innovation and change over the past two years,” and added, “We will make the Opportunity Development Zone a leading model that meets the government's expectations by promoting corporate investment attraction and providing quality living environments in connection with the semiconductor specialized complex and defense innovation cluster.”
